How much funding has Robin.io raised?

Robin.io has raised a total of $39M across 5 funding rounds:

2013

Angel/Seed

$2.4M

2014

Private Equity

$4.3M

2015

Series A

$15M

2018

Series B

$17M

2020

Debt

$350K

Angel/Seed (2013): $2.4M, investors not publicly disclosed

Private Equity (2014): $4.3M, investors not publicly disclosed

Series A (2015): $15M supported by DN Capital, Hasso Plattner Ventures, and USAA

Series B (2018): $17M featuring USAA Ventures

Debt (2020): $350K backed by PPP

Key Investors in Robin.io

DN Capital

DN Capital is a global early-stage venture capital firm founded in 2000, focusing on Seed, Series A, and select Series B opportunities across Software, AI, Fintech, and Consumer Internet sectors.

Hasso Plattner Ventures

Hasso Plattner Ventures invests in fast-growing, information technology-driven companies, acting as a strategic partner for startups and expansion-stage firms globally.

USAA

USAA is a diversified financial services organization specializing in banking, insurance, and investment products, with a strong focus on serving the U.S. military community.
